Abstract

A front syringe attachment is provided for mounting on a syringe cylinder of hypodermic syringes for subcutaneous injection, particularly for use in veterinary medicine, which substantially includes a first hollow-cylindrical barrel and a second hollow-cylindrical barrel of smaller diameter which is arranged in the latter in a telescoping manner, wherein the end of the first barrel facing the syringe cylinder is fastened to the syringe cylinder and the end of the second barrel facing the syringe cylinder can be pushed into the first barrel against a spring arranged in the first barrel, and the ends of the two barrels on the injecting side have a step-like or stair-like construction, wherein the end of the second barrel on the injecting side projects beyond the end of the first barrel on the injecting side in the rest position and completely covers the hypodermic needle.
